Abstract: In the present study, we developed a rich and focused knowledge graph that explores complex relationships between a variety of entities such as genes, diseases, chemicals, and variants related to lncRNAs. This information has been aggregated from thousands of high-quality sources, including PharmGKB, CTD, and DisGeNET, lncRNASNP v3, LncRNADisease v3.0, resulting in a dataset of more than 4.5 million unique relationships. Applying the complete standardization process, Gilda in our case, we curated the identifiers and enriched the data with high-ranking associations. This graph contains both directed and bidirectional relations, enabling the exploration of complex biological interactions or relations. By calibrating uneven degree distributions and combining a combinatorial approach, we identified six critical pairwise relationships, such as Gene-Disease and Chemical-Variant, Chemical-Gene, Chemical Disease, Gene-Variant, Disease-Variant associations, ensuring comprehensive coverage of biomedical knowledge. We developed a shortest path length-based method to predict target genes for long non-coding RNAs (lncRNAs) using a knowledge graph (KG). By extracting all lncRNAs and genes from the KG, we constructed a distance matrix where each entry represented the shortest path length between an lncRNA and a gene, calculated using the Breadth-First Search (BFS) algorithm. Genes with a path score below the mean for a given lncRNA were identified as potential targets. Predictions were validated using benchmark datasets from LncTarD and RNAInter, ensuring reliability and alignment with experimentally validated interactions.
